Noun[edit]

crashing (plural crashings)

  1. The sound or action of something that crashes.
    the ceaseless crashings of waves on the beach

Adjective[edit]

crashing

  1. Severe; drastic.
    • 2016, Simon R. Green, Deathstalker War:
      Advances were brought to crashing halts, and whole areas became impassable.
    • 2020, Donald J. Lange, The Life and Poetry of George Darley, page 114:
      That the debut of the play on 20 April 1842 was a crashing failure is apparent from a letter from Charles []
